Rangers put RHP Ogando on DL for 3rd time in ’13

The Columbian
Published: August 19, 2013, 5:00pm

ARLINGTON, Texas (AP) — The Texas Rangers are putting right-hander Alexi Ogando on the disabled list for the third time this season.

Texas made the move before Tuesday night’s game, three days after Ogando (5-4) had an injection because of an inflamed nerve in his right shoulder. The DL stint is retroactive to Aug. 14, the day after Ogando’s last start.

Left-hander Travis Blackley was selected from Triple-A Round Rock to take Ogando’s spot in the rotation against Houston. Blackley had been at Round Rock since being acquired from Houston in a trade last week.

Ogando missed three weeks earlier this season because of right biceps tendinitis, then made only one start — on June 5 — before going back on the DL due to right shoulder inflammation.
